The Edmonton Oilers beat the Winnipeg Jets last night 3-2 in overtime in there first pre-season game. There weren’t many headliners in the Oilers lineup with players like Drake Cagguila, Ty Emberson and Collin Delia filling out the veteran roles. Sam O’Reilly and Matthew Savoie dressed to showcase the future in Edmonton. O’Reilly and Lavoie scored in regulation and Cam Dineen snapped home the overtime winner.
